Understanding the "Least Expensive Chanel Bag" Myth:

The term "least expensive Chanel bag" is itself misleading. Chanel meticulously controls its pricing, and while variations exist based on size, material, and specific design details, a truly "cheap" Chanel bag simply doesn't exist in the context of a new, directly purchased item from an authorized retailer. The brand’s image and legacy are built on exclusivity and high-quality craftsmanship, which directly translates into high prices. Any purportedly "cheap" Chanel bag should immediately raise red flags.

Exploring the Secondary Market: Pre-Owned and Vintage Chanel:

The most realistic path to finding a Chanel bag under $1500 lies in the pre-owned and vintage market. This is where patient searching, thorough authentication, and a keen eye for detail become crucial. Platforms like eBay, The RealReal, Fashionphile, and Vestiaire Collective offer a wide selection of pre-owned Chanel bags, with prices varying significantly based on condition, style, age, and rarity. A well-preserved vintage Chanel bag from the 1980s or 1990s, for instance, might fall within the desired price range, though it’s important to note that even vintage pieces can command substantial prices depending on their desirability.

The Importance of Authentication:

When venturing into the pre-owned market, authentication is non-negotiable. Counterfeit Chanel bags are prevalent, and purchasing a fake, believing it to be authentic, can result in significant financial loss. Reputable online platforms often offer authentication services, but it's always advisable to conduct thorough research and, if possible, have the bag authenticated by an expert before finalizing the purchase. Look for subtle details like stitching quality, hardware markings, and the overall feel of the leather – these can help distinguish an authentic Chanel from a cleverly crafted imitation.
